INTRODUCTORY STATEMENT

This handbook is designed to acquaint you with Wilkinson Electric & Ace Mechanical Contractors, Inc. (Wilkinson/Ace) and provide you with information about working conditions, employee benefits, and some of the policies affecting your employment. You should read, understand, and comply with all provisions of the handbook. It describes many of your responsibilities as an employee and outlines the programs developed by Wilkinson/Ace to benefit employees. One of our objectives is to provide a work environment that is conducive to both personal and professional growth.

No employee handbook can anticipate every circumstance or question about policy. In order to retain necessary flexibility in the administration of policies and procedures, Wilkinson/Ace reserves the right to revise, supplement, or rescind any policies or portion of the handbook from time to time as it deems appropriate, in its sole and absolute discretion. The only exception to any changes is our employment-at-will policy permitting you or Wilkinson/Ace to end our relationship for any reason at any time. This handbook is not an employment contract and is not intended to create contractual obligations of any kind. If it is necessary to make changes to any policy or procedure, employees will be notified, in writing, of those changes and their effective date.

You are encouraged to refer to this manual with any questions concerning the policies or procedures of Wilkinson/Ace.
